causaldag.classes.dag.DAG.to_nx

DAG.to_nx() → networkx.classes.digraph.DiGraph[source]

Convert DAG to a networkx DiGraph.

Returns:The graph as a networkx.DiGraph object.
Return type:networkx.DiGraph

Examples

>>> import causaldag as cd
>>> d = cd.DAG(arcs={(0, 1)})
>>> g = d.to_nx()
>>> g.edges
OutEdgeView([(0, 1)])